The Union Budget 2025-26 has proposed several exemptions under Basic Customs Duty (BCD) to rationalise tariff structures, boost domestic manufacturing, and provide relief to consumers.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man, in her Budget speech, announced sector-specific relaxations, including exemptions for life-saving drugs, critical minerals, lithium-ion battery components, and shipbuilding materials.
The government has fully exempted 36 additional life-saving drugs from BCD to provide relief to patients suffering from cancer, rare diseases, and chronic ailments. Six new medicines have been added to the list of those attracting a concessional 5% customs duty. Bulk drugs used in the manufacture of these medicines will also benefit from the exemption.
As many as 37 additional medicines under pharmaceutical companies’ Patient Assistance Programmes have been granted full exemption, along with 13 new patient assistance programmes.
The government has fully exempted BCD on cobalt powder and waste, lithium-ion battery scrap, lead, zinc, and 12 other critical minerals to ensure the availability of key raw materials for domestic industries.
Two additional types of shuttle-less looms have been included in the list of fully exempted textile machinery to support the domestic production of technical textile products like agro-textiles, medical textiles, and geo-textiles.
As part of the government’s ‘Make in India’ initiative and efforts to correct the inverted duty structure, the BCD on interactive flat panel displays (IFPDs) has been increased from 10% to 20%, while it has been reduced to 5% on open cells and other components.
A total of 35 additional capital goods for electric vehicle (EV) battery manufacturing and 28 capital goods for mobile phone battery manufacturing have been added to the exemption list.
Recognising the long gestation period of shipbuilding, the BCD exemption on raw materials, components, consumables, and parts for ship manufacturing has been extended for another 10 years.
A similar exemption has been granted to the ship-breaking industry to make it more competitive.
The BCD on Carrier Grade Ethernet Switches has been reduced from 20% to 10%, aligning it with non-carrier grade switches.
The export period for handicraft goods has been extended from six months to one year, with an additional three-month extension if required. Nine more items have been added to the duty-free input list.
Wet blue leather has been fully exempted from BCD to boost domestic value addition and employment. Sitharaman also proposed to exempt crust leather from 20% export duty to facilitate exports by small tanners.
The BCD on frozen fish paste (Surimi) has been reduced from 30% to 5%, while the duty on fish hydrolysate for manufacturing fish and shrimp feed has been cut from 15% to 5%.
Commodity | From (%) | To (%) |
---|---|---|
Frozen fish paste (surimi) for manufacture of surimi analogue products for export | 30 | 5 |
Fish hydrolysate for manufacture of aquatic feed | 15 | 5 |
Other compounds containing a pyrimidine ring (whether or not hydrogenated) or piperazine ring in the structure classified under tariff subheading 2933 59 | 10 | 7.5 |
Synthetic flavouring essences and mixtures of odoriferous substances of a kind used in food or drink industries classified under tariff subheading 3302 10 | 100 | 20 |
Sorbitol classified under tariff subheading 3824 60 | 30 | 20 |
Waste and scrap of Antimony, Beryllium, Bismuth, Cobalt, Cadmium, Molybdenum, Rhenium, Tantalum, Tin, Tungsten, Zirconium, Copper scrap covered under tariff items 74040012, 74040019 and 74040022 | 10/5/2.5 | Nil |
Waste and scrap of Lithium-Ion Battery | 5 | Nil |
Cobalt powder | 5 | Nil |
Waste and scrap of Lead | 5 | Nil |
Waste and scrap Zinc | 5 | Nil |
Addition of 6 more medicines in List 3 and bulk drugs for their manufacture | As applicable | 5 |
Addition of 36 more medicines in List 4 and bulk drugs for their manufacture | As applicable | Nil |
Addition of 37 more medicines and 13 Patient Assistance Programmes in the list of duty-free imports by pharmaceutical companies for supply free of cost to patients | As applicable | Nil |
Platinum findings | 25 | 6.4 (5 BCD + 1.4 AIDC) |
Wet blue leather | 10 | Nil |
Shuttle less loom Rapier Looms (below 650 meters per minute) and Shuttle less loom Air jet Looms (below 1000 meters per minute) for use in textile industry | 7.5 | Nil |
Certain additional items for duty-free import by bona fide exporters for manufacture of handicrafts | As applicable | Nil |
Addition of 35 capital goods/machinery for use in the manufacture of lithium-ion battery of EVs and 28 capital goods/machinery for use in the manufacture of lithium-ion battery of mobile phones | As applicable | Nil |
Inputs/parts and sub-parts of PCBA, camera module, connectors and inputs or raw materials for use in manufacture of wired headset, microphone and receiver, USB cable, fingerprint reader/sensor of cellular mobile phone | 2.5 | Nil |
Specified inputs/parts (chip on film, PCBA, glass board/substrate cell) for use in manufacture of open cells of TV panels of LED/LCD TV | 2.5 | Nil |
Ethernet Switches Carrier-Grade | 20 | 10 |
Open cell (with or without touch) for interactive Flat Panel Display module, Touch Glass sheet, and Touch Sensor PCB for use in manufacture of Interactive Flat Panel Display module | 15/10 | 5 |
Ground installation for satellites including its spares and consumables | As applicable | Nil |
Goods used in the building of launch vehicles and launching of satellites | 5 | Nil |
Motorcycles | ||
(i) Engine capacity not exceeding 1600 CC (CBU) | 50 | 40 |
(ii) Semi-knocked down (SKD) | 25 | 20 |
(iii) Completely knocked down (CKD) | 15 | 10 |
(i) Engine capacity 1600 CC & above (CBU) | 50 | 30 |
(ii) Semi-knocked down (SKD) | 25 | 20 |
(iii) Completely knocked down (CKD) | 15 | 10 |
